Re: telemetry payload compression in the Farrowbeam collector — looks fine overall, but flagging for the release notes. We now gzip batches above the size threshold instead of compressing every payload, which cut CPU on the edge nodes noticeably in staging. Below the threshold we ship plain JSON. This changes wire format negotiation, so the agent rollout must precede the collector rollout. Ship order matters. The thresholds we settled on are:

limits module of yadug-tawip:
QUOTAS = {
    "julael": 705,
    "kasael": 903,
    "druwyn": 489,
}

### 2.8.1 — Sort stability fix + key rotation

Fixed the Reportello builder so rows with equal values keep their original order (stable sort, finally). Since the old pipeline key predates our rotation policy, we rotated it as part of this release. Old key is revoked as of this build. New public signing key for verification follows.

deploy key for kajof-fajop: bky6_gDHw9Q

If the Fanout sidecar on a Quillhaven node stops shipping aggregates, first check that the scrape interval matches the upstream flush cadence — mismatches silently drop buckets. Restart with `fanout-agent --drain` so in-flight counters flush before shutdown. Do not clear the spool directory; Tamsin's team uses it for replay. Confirm the dashboard shows fresh points within two minutes. When filing the incident note, paste the currently running build token, shown below.

trace token, kahog-tajeg: htk6_97d963